3. The Original Pipebomb

CM Punk, Pipebomb
WWE.com

Hey, nobody said a bizarre ending is synonymous with a bad one.

CM Punk's landmark promo in 2011 was many fans' return point to professional wrestling (including my own). The Chicago native explicitly aired his own grievances, but the subtext of his words were clear. WWE had been freewheeling since the Attitude Era, often in the face of good storytelling and good entertainment.

Various parts of the promo were utterly gobsmacking: Punk namedropping other promotions such as NJPW and ROH, running down The Rock's backstage ass-kissing, shouting out his pal Colt Cabana, and - perhaps most shockingly - stating that WWE would be better if Vince McMahon were dead.

Punk changed the game without question, and sent the internet wrestling community into a frenzy.
